The residential building at Hagelkreuzstrasse 22 is in Mönchengladbach ( North Rhine-Westphalia ).

The building was built in 1905. It was entered under No. H 079 on December 6, 1994 in the monuments list of the city of Mönchengladbach .

location

Hagelkreuzstraße is located in the northern urban expansion area in an exposed residential area between the New Water Tower and the Colorful Garden .

architecture

A two-and-a-half-storey plastered building with a loft stands above the high basement base . Horizontally structured by basement, floor and eaves cornices . Asymmetrical facade design with emphasis on the left half of the house by means of a bay window and curved gable ; Edged on both sides by a pilaster strip across each floor . In the case of an unequal axis formation, different floor-by-floor window designs: on the ground floor to the left of the round-arched house entrance crowned with an oval ox-eye three arched windows; the two of the left half of the facade are linked together by plaster framing.

The wall surface of the upper floor is opened on the right by two tall rectangular windows with a keystone ; narrow in korbbogig arched bay five through brick fighters horizontally structured window openings. A single rectangular window in the pediment. The surface of the gable roof breaks through a round arched dormer . The flat stucco ornamentation with finely modeled decorative elements (festoons, medallions, vase) is based on an Art Nouveau style influenced by the forms of the Louis XVI style .
